Engagement Coordinator vacancy waiting to be filled

Venn Group have been approached by a Charity and would like to introduce the following position available

Position:          Engagement Officer  

Location:         Morecambe  

Salary:               £20,540 per annuum

Hours:             33.5 hours p/week

Length:            Permanent

The role will predominantly involve:

  •   Delivering Educational and Leisure Activities
  • Daily Administration tasks including completing Risk Assessments
  • Raising the profile of our young people and service by establishing, developing & building sustainable relationships with local community services to provide access to opportunities for young people. 
  • Helping with OFSTED & Foyer Federation Accreditation
  • Planning Educational activities and offering support and understanding to young people

 The successful candidate must be able to start within short notice, Have an Enhanced DBS and have experience working with young people
